Idris Elba hospitalised

idris_elba
British actor Idris Elba was hospitalised in the UK Saturday after he had an asthma attack while on his way to the premiere of his new movie “Mandela: Long Walk To Freedom” in Johannesburg.

The star of the new film about the life of former South African president Nelson Mandela is recovering after suffering the attack on his way to the film’s premiere. The incident happened on a plane but he was taken off before the flight left the United Kingdom.

He was unable to attend a news conference surrounding the film in South Africa because of illness.

Elba stars in the movie alongside fellow British star Naomie Harris who will play Mandela’s former wife Winnie in the movie.

Harris has had roles in such movies as the James Bond flick “Skyfall” where she played Miss Moneypenny.

The film tells the story of Mandela’s imprisonment on Robben Island and his later release and election to the South African presidency. The movie premiered at the Toronto Film Festival in September.

Elba moved to South Africa for three months during the filming to help him better understand the society. The film is set to be released in January next year.

Tim Roth for Sepp Blatter film

5242273

British actor Tim Roth has signed up to star as the head of football’s world governing body FIFA in a new movie about Joseph Sepp Blatter.

Blatter the Swiss boss of the football body and the movie will be based on his life and will not only coincide with the FIFA World Cup Football Finals inBrazil in 2014 but also the 110th anniversary of the Geneva-based organisation.French star Gerard Depardieu will also star in the film.

The movie will be made by a French production company and will tell about the formation of FIFA in 1904 to the present day.

Roth will play Blatter while Depardieu will play the former FIFA president Jules Rimet after whom the World Cup trophy is named. Rimet was president of FIFA from 1921 to 1954.

Blatter, who is often controversial, has said he is pleased about the casting for the film and is happy about being portrayed by Roth on film.

“I had read a lot of the CV and (seen) all the realisations (films) that Tim Roth has made. I was very eager to meet him, and I have just realised that really we have something in common,” Blatter was quoted by Reuters as saying.

Filming for the movie will take place in FranceBrazil, and Azerbaijan.

King’s Speech top UK real life film

the_king's_speech
King George VI was one of the UK’s favourite kings and now the movie about his life is the top British real life film.

The King’s Speech, which won British actor Colin Firth the Academy Award for Best Actor in 2011, has been named the top UK real life film in a poll conducted by American Express.

The film, directed by Tom Hooper, won 28 per cent of the votes.

The 2008 movie The Boys in the Striped Pyjamas which was directed by Mark Herman was the runner up while Steven Spielberg’s 2012 film Lincoln which tells the story of the American president was third.

Mark Zuckerberg’s story The Social Network which told about the emergence of Facebook was also in the running with 127 Hours, the story of a man trapped while mountain climbing was also in the running in fifth.

The poll was conducted at the end of last week’s London Film Festival which had several real life movies making their premiere.

The top ten in that order are 1. The King’s Speech, 2. The Boys in the Striped Pyjamas, 3. Lincoln, 4. The Social Netwrok, 5. 127 Hours, 6. Argo, 7. The Impossible, 8. The Blind Side, 9. Valkyrie, 10. Zero Dark Thirty.
